Output 66b4eab7da16bc466c1fa68839365559e17d009a0fca6117fb6bc2e776b1fe6a:1

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 589ad6e75885092fb52846afee65c570c03c0315
address
bc1qtzddde6cs5yjldfgg6h7uew9wrqrcqc4qs27e3
transaction
66b4eab7da16bc466c1fa68839365559e17d009a0fca6117fb6bc2e776b1fe6a
spent
true